Introduction: The modern ophthalmology trends are changing rapidly every day with the introduction of much newer studies and research. Numerous anti-vascular endothelial growth factors (VEGF) are utilized as the mainstay in the treatment of intraocular vascular pathologies. The rationale of this study is to add to the literature regarding the safety and efficacy profile of the ziv-aflibercept as there is insubstantial data in patients with intraocular vascular pathologies being treated with this injection with prime focus on the complications of the injection. Materials and Methods: A prospective observational study was conducted at Opthalmology Department, Lahore General Hospital, Lahore between 14 August 2018 and 23 December 2019. Patients with choroidal and retinal vascular diseases like diabetic macular edema (DME), age-related macular degeneration (AMD) and retinal vein occlusion (RVO) who had no active infection of eye and had no history of myocardial infarction or cerebrovascular accident were added in this study. Results: Best-corrected visual acuity was significantly improved at 4, 8, and 12 weeks as compared to the baseline (p Conclusion: The use of ziv-aflibercept injection via intravitreal route under aseptic conditions for choroidal and retinal vascular diseases is effective as well as safe with mild and treatable ocular side effects. 展开更多

Ziv-afilbercept(Zaltrap, Ziv) is a humanized fusion protein constructed by joining the vascular endothelial growth factor(VEGF) binding portions of human VEGF receptors 1 and 2 to the Fc portion of human immunoglobulin IgG 1. Recently, a randomized, open-label, phase Ⅲ study compared 5-fluorouracil, leucovorin, irinotecan(FOLFIRI)/Ziv with FOLFIRI/placebo in patients who had been previously treated with oxaliplatin based chemotherapy for metastatic colon cancer(mC RC). Patients who had received prior bevacizumab therapy were also eligible. This study showed that the addition of Ziv improved overall survival with median survival time of 13.5 mo vs 12.06 mo in ziv vs placebo arm. Ziv also improved progression free survival from 4.67 mo to 6.9 mo with a response rate of 19.8% in the Ziv/FOLFIRI group vs 11.1% in FOLFIRI alone group. This led to the approval of Ziv in combination with FOLFIRI in metastatic colon cancer patients treated with prior oxaliplatin regimens. The mostcommon side effects were diarrhea, stomatitis, fatigue, hypertension, weight loss, loss of appetite, abdominal pain, and headache. As the use of Ziv has become more widespread in oncology practices, familiarity with the toxicity profile of the drug and the use of practice guidelines for their treatment has become increasing important. This review will address the toxicities noted in trials using Ziv for the treatment of mC RC, and will provide recommendations for toxicity management. 展开更多

新生血管生成是结直肠癌发生、生长和转移的重要机制之一。阿柏西普作为血管内皮生长因子(vascular endothelial growth factor,VEGF)的可溶性诱饵受体,作用于靶点VEGF-A、VEGF-B和胎盘生长因子(placental growth factor,PIGF)抑制肿瘤... 新生血管生成是结直肠癌发生、生长和转移的重要机制之一。阿柏西普作为血管内皮生长因子(vascular endothelial growth factor,VEGF)的可溶性诱饵受体,作用于靶点VEGF-A、VEGF-B和胎盘生长因子(placental growth factor,PIGF)抑制肿瘤血管的生成。最近多项研究表明阿柏西普对多种实体瘤尤其转移性结直肠癌(metastatic colorectal cancer,m CRC)有明确的抗肿瘤作用。而且美国食品药品监督管理局和欧洲药物管理局已批准阿柏西普联合5-氟尿嘧啶、亚叶酸钙和伊立替康方案(5-fluorouracil,leucovorin,irinotecan,FOLFIRI)可用于二线治疗对奥沙利铂为基础的化疗方案耐药或进展的m CRC患者。该文就阿柏西普抗血管生成的作用机制和在m CRC中的临床试验作一综述。 展开更多

针对特异性分子靶点的靶向药物治疗已成为转移性结直肠癌(m CRC)治疗的新方向。2012年Ziv-阿柏西普被美国食品和药物管理局批准用于m CRC患者,Ziv-阿柏西普是一种作用于血管生成信号通路的重组融合蛋白,通过与血管内皮生长因子(VEGF)受... 针对特异性分子靶点的靶向药物治疗已成为转移性结直肠癌(m CRC)治疗的新方向。2012年Ziv-阿柏西普被美国食品和药物管理局批准用于m CRC患者,Ziv-阿柏西普是一种作用于血管生成信号通路的重组融合蛋白,通过与血管内皮生长因子(VEGF)受体结合,从而阻断肿瘤的生长和转移。一项Ⅲ期临床研究结果显示Ziv-阿柏西普能显著延长m CRC患者的生存期。本文结合国内外最新研究报道,对Ziv-阿柏西普治疗m CRC的研究进展作一综述。 展开更多
